2025-08-22 16:03:00 +0000 UTC

Distribute Elements Into Two Arrays I

Code

class Solution:
    def resultArray(self, nums):
        len_nums = len(nums)
        arr1 = [nums[0]]
        arr2 = [nums[1]]
        for i in range(2, len(nums)):
            if arr1[-1] > arr2[-1]:
                arr1.append(nums[i])
            else:
                arr2.append(nums[i])
        arr1.extend(arr2)
        return arr1